What Happened?

The Andreanof Islands earthquake of 8.6 Mw occurred in the Aleutian Islands, a region well known for its frequent seismic activity due to the complex tectonic interactions between the Pacific and North American Plates. This particular event unleashed significant ground movement and generated a tsunami that had devastating effects on the local environment and communities. The earthquake's epicenter was located near the Andreanof Islands, which are part of Alaska's remote Aleutian archipelago. In the days following, reports estimated that damages exceeded $5 million, highlighting both the economic and physical impact of this natural disaster.

Inadequate infrastructure in the region, coupled with the sudden nature of the earthquake, contributed to the extensive damage that followed. The tsunami posed additional hazards, complicating rescue and relief efforts and leading to further destruction of buildings, homes, and essential services. The US Coast Guard and other emergency services were mobilized to assess the damage and provide assistance to affected communities, which faced immediate challenges in recovery. Conte Announces First Nationwide COVID-19 Lockdown

March 9th, 2020 5 years ago

On March 9, 2020, Giuseppe Conte, the Prime Minister of Italy, delivered a significant televised address wherein he outlined a nationwide lockdown in response to the rapidly escalating COVID-19 pandemic. This decisive measure was aimed at curbing the spread of the virus, which had gained alarming momentum in Italy. As part of the decree, strict restrictions were placed on movement, gatherings, and non-essential activities across the country, marking Italy as the first nation to adopt such extensive lockdown measures in the face of the pandemic.

Mid-air Collision of Two Helicopters in Argentina

March 9th, 2015 10 years ago

Two Eurocopter AS350 Écureuil helicopters collided in mid-air over Villa Castelli, Argentina, resulting in the loss of all ten individuals aboard both aircraft. Among the deceased were French athletes Florence Arthaud, Camille Muffat, and Alexis Vastine, alongside several producers and guests involved with the French television show 'Dropped.' This tragic incident occurred during filming in a remote area, highlighting the risks associated with such aerial productions.

Space Shuttle Discovery's Final Landing

March 9th, 2011 14 years ago

Space Shuttle Discovery completed its historic final landing at Kennedy Space Center, marking the end of a remarkable 30-year career. It was the shuttle's 39th mission, and it returned from a 13-day mission to the International Space Station. Discovery played a crucial role in building the ISS, launching the Hubble Space Telescope, and conducting numerous scientific experiments. The landing concluded with a touching farewell to the shuttle, which had become an iconic symbol of American space exploration.
